DATEADD (Analisi dei flussi di Azure)

Restituisce una data specificata con l'intervallo numerico specificato (valore Integer firmato) aggiunto a un datepart specificato della data.

Sintassi

DATEADD ( datepart , number, date )  

Argomenti

datepart

Parte di startdate e di enddate che specifica il tipo di limite superato. La tabella seguente contiene tutti gli argomenti validi per datepart.

datepart Abbreviazioni
anno yy, yyyy
quarter qq, q
month mm, m
dayofyear dy, y
day dd, d
week wk, ww
giorno feriale dw, w
hour hh
minute mi, n
second ss, s
millisecondo ms
microsecondo mcs

number

Espressione che può essere risolta in un bigint aggiunto a un datepart della data. Se si specifica un valore con una frazione decimale, la frazione verrà troncata senza arrotondamento.

date

Espressione che può essere risolta in un valore datetime. date può essere un'espressione, un'espressione di colonna o un valore letterale stringa

Tipi restituiti

bigint

Esempi

SELECT DATEADD(hour,2,EntryTime) AS AdjustedTime
FROM Input TIMESTAMP BY EntryTime  
WHERE Toll > 5